Raiders' Bush instant success -- a year later
Raiders' Bush instant success -- a year later
ALAMEDA One carry. That's all he wanted. One play even. Just put me in coach, I'm ready to play. It wasn't to be. Day after day, practice after practice, running back Michael Bush watched from afar last season, yearning for the opportunity to make his NFL debut with the Raiders. The year passed ...
